Note: 1. When using an electromagnetic brake, determine the power supply by taking the rated current
value of the electromagnetic brake into consideration.
2. Configure up the power supply circuit which will switch off power upon detection of alarm
occurrence.
When the servo amplifier has become faulty, switch power off on the servo
amplifier power side. Continuous flow of a large current may cause a fire.
